More Mistakes

"I've learned so much from my mistakes...I'm thinking of making a few more."

This was included in my church's bulletin one week. I disagreed strongly with this statement the first time I read it. "We aren't supposed to try to make mistakes," my mind shouted. But we are. I mean, not sin mistakes. We should avoid those to the best of our ability! But other mistakes? Yes. Absolutely. Try something new. Fail. Try again, and succeed.

I don't like to fail, so sometimes I let opportunities pass by me. I'm learning to embrace every opportunity I can, and say "yes," more than I say "no." Sometimes this is still difficult for me, but I am getting better.

Don't be afraid to try just because you might make a mistake. Just be sure to acknowledge your mistake and learn from it. Then, try again.

Ask yourself:

  1. Where did I make a mistake?
  2. What could I have done better?
  3. Is this still something at which I want to succeed?
  4. What will I change if I do this again?


I know it's easy to say and hard to do. I have to keep reminding myself that the people who have accomplished great things took risks, and tried their best. I'm in the process of setting new goals for myself. It's scary. The process for reaching some of those goals is scary, because taking risks and stepping out of my comfort zone makes me extremely uncomfortable. But I can never succeed if I never try.
